United States welcomes Armenian-Turkish dialogue
![]() 1466 Saturday, 15 January, 2022, 13:42 The United States welcomes the first meeting between the Armenian and Turkish special envoys. ''We warmly welcome the Armenian-Turkish dialogue and the involvement of the two countries in diplomacy and dialogue for resolving existing disagreements between each other,'' the U.S. State Department told the Voice of America’s. |
